Salary of Computer Information Systems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$61,460 Bachelor's Median Salary

Computer Information Systems students who finish a bachelor’s at AIU Houston go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$61,460 a year. This is above $48,335, the median for all majors at AIU Houston.

Student Debt of Computer Information Systems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$45,606 Bachelor's Median Debt

While getting their bachelor’s degree at AIU Houston, computer information systems students borrow a median amount of $45,606 in student loans. This is higher than $39,385, the typical median for all majors at AIU Houston.
